PhotoManipulation for ads, October 2019
When I worked at foodspring in 2019, I was the go-to designer for the Performance Marketing team. It happened quite frequently that ads would suffer from so-called "Image Fatigue". With a strict photography budget, I often had to be quite resourceful in finding and creating "new" images.
In the following ad set, only the apple-flavoured product variant was actually a real photograph. From this, I was able to manipulate the photo using our mockups and packaging design files to also display the rest of the line and other similarly packaged products.
From there, I also created simple ads, based on the best performing texts provided by the Performance Marketing team.
